Fire Strike is a DirectX 11 benchmark for gaming PCs. It features two separate tests displaying a fight between a humanoid and a fiery creature made of lava. Using 1920x1080 resolution, Fire Strike shows off some realistic graphics and is quite taxing on hardware.

Pros & cons summary


Performance score 11.39 12.68
Recency 31 January 2012 7 January 2018
Maximum RAM amount 3 GB 4 GB
Chip lithography 28 nm 14 nm
Power consumption (TDP) 200 Watt 65 Watt

RX Vega M GL / 870 has a 11.3% higher aggregate performance score, an age advantage of 5 years, a 33.3% higher maximum VRAM amount, a 100% more advanced lithography process, and 207.7% lower power consumption.

The Radeon RX Vega M GL / 870 is our recommended choice as it beats the Radeon HD 7950 in performance tests.

Be aware that Radeon HD 7950 is a desktop graphics card while Radeon RX Vega M GL / 870 is a notebook one.
